You know that is a really good question. With these same loads I would guess probably greater penetration. Now before everyone piles on and says BS give me a minute.

With the shorter barrel you will get lower velocity. Take the Sierra 210gr it seems to only expand in my testing at 1100fps or greater. I have seen the 210gr penetrate 24inches when shot at 1000fps with no expansion.

So if I shot the same loads out of the 69 with shorter barrel the theory is at lower velocities these rounds would not expand therefore potential deeper penetration.
